Petr Pavel is a Czech politician and former general who currently serves as the President of the Czech Republic. He emphasizes the importance of maintaining high-level relations with Slovakia and has expressed commitment to strengthening the ties between the two nations, reflecting their shared history and cultural connections.

Born on Nov 01, 1961 (63 years old)
